When I raised this possibility before I think I aproached it wrongly to get the response I wanted.
The team where every player is as good as possible in a balanced team at their job.
I think the thrower should have
mv 5 - enough to cover the field (just) but you need 2 to develope the best passing game
St 2 and AV 6 or 7 since they arn't supposed to hang around and get hit.
They could ahve passing skills only.
Catcher would be very like a woodelf catcher
Blocker Ag1, St 4, move 4 I think?
Blitzer - I'm not sure. I think Ag 3 so thy can have a reasonable attempt at ball handling and dodging but without the finess of ag4. St 3 for the same reason. It depends on what the "essential blitzer" is.
Full back/defensive saftey start with passblock and probably ag4

Hmmm... I think a 7-3-3-8 Horns, Leap Blitzer might be better. Still costs out to 90k, and needs TWO stat rolls to replace a catcher, instead of one MA roll.David Bergkvist wrote:Code: Select all
0-12 Lineman 50k 4 3 1 9 G Thick Skull, Regenerate 0-2 Thrower 70k 6 2 4 7 GP Pass, Sure Hands 0-2 Catcher 90k 8 2 4 7 GA Catch, Dodge, Nerves of Steel 0-4 Blitzer 90k 7 3 4 7 GA Horns, Leap
That, or leave the Blitzer as is and give him General and Strength access, so that he can't get Catch or Dodge on normal skill rolls. Otherwise, I WOULD develop a Blitzer as a third catcher, which defeats the original team concept (position players who are great at their position, but can't play another position).
I'll run both versions through the old analysis spreadsheet and see what my proposals do. Back in 15 minutes.

OK, numbers crunched. If you want the full list of values, I'll post them tomorrow, but the original team was near the bottom of the LRB teams, and definitely not overpowered. My suggestions LOWERED the power of the team in both cases.
I am even more in favor of the 7-3-3-8 Blitzer now. It's too easy to make your fourth blitzer into a third catcher as is, in my opinion. Then again, my record as a coach says that my judgement is laughable.

Values are pretty simple to do. http://home.earthlink.net/~agentrock/pdf/pcost.htm (just for reference)
Using this pricing guide, your lineman cost out at 60,000. Throwers are 60,000, Catchers are 120,000, and the blitzer is a 120,000 player. If the blitzer's stat line is turned into an 8 3 3 8 as suggested, he prices out as about the same.
Strangely, the team resembles the Necromantic team most in composition.

I didn't think about the problem of allowing a blitzer to develop to a catcher.
However, I don't really like the AG 3 blitzer, since a blitzer that only dodges on 3+ and leaps on 4+ isn't very good at blitzing in my opinion. And it still allows him to do other things than blitz.
Here's an even more extreme team:
(M means they can pick physical abilities)
The fluff could be that there are two species: one that is mansized (the linemen) and one small two-headed type with mutations (the catchers and blitzers). The throwers would be the offspring between a member of the mansized species and the stunty two-headed species. How the tiny blitzers manage to get AV 9 is anyone's guess.
